If you are new to bullet journaling, these pages are great to use as a starting point to build better habits. The more you track and use your journal, the more confidence you’ll gain in creating your own customized tracking pages. (If you’re looking for inspiration, here are some darling habit tracker page ideas.)
You can track bed time, wake up time, exercise, water intake, affirmations, chores, money spent…the list of what habits you can track is endless. This set of BUJO habit tracker printables supports creating and tracking healthy routines, consistency, and self awareness. And will ultimately help you achieve your goals faster.
